Skip to content

Commit 5775ebb

Browse files
committed
add disableLogging
1 parent 9365d61 commit 5775ebb

File tree

2 files changed

+4
-2
lines changed

2 files changed

+4
-2
lines changed

WebViewJavascriptBridge/WebViewJavascriptBridge.h

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,7 @@ typedef void (^WVJBHandler)(id data, WVJBResponseCallback responseCallback);
77
+ (id)bridgeForWebView:(UIWebView*)webView handler:(WVJBHandler)handler;
88
+ (id)bridgeForWebView:(UIWebView*)webView webViewDelegate:(id <UIWebViewDelegate>)webViewDelegate handler:(WVJBHandler)handler;
99
+ (void)enableLogging;
10+
+ (void)disableLogging;
1011
- (void)send:(id)message;
1112
- (void)send:(id)message responseCallback:(WVJBResponseCallback)responseCallback;
1213
- (void)registerHandler:(NSString*)handlerName handler:(WVJBHandler)handler;

WebViewJavascriptBridge/WebViewJavascriptBridge.m

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-45,8 +45,9 @@ + (id)bridgeForWebView:(UIWebView *)webView webViewDelegate:(id<UIWebViewDelegat
4545
return bridge;
4646
}
4747

48-
static bool logging = false;
49-
+ (void)enableLogging { logging = true; }
48+
static bool logging = NO;
49+
+ (void)enableLogging { logging = YES; }
50+
+ (void)disableLogging { logging = NO; }
5051

5152
- (void)send:(NSDictionary *)data {
5253
[self send:data responseCallback:nil];

0 commit comments

Comments
 (0)